Output e7405255c90cb5e1b388e92c19a38008cdda19f3384fc956672b1f85ab4b0f2b:7

value
45352587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97ad5b84537e246b9367e43402f513a790b3248a OP_EQUAL
address
MMj9wV9AwN6GtFchzDfUGeyH4oLKLijhkU
transaction
e7405255c90cb5e1b388e92c19a38008cdda19f3384fc956672b1f85ab4b0f2b
spent
true